HANDLING AND OPERATING INSTRUCTIONS FOR ROCKET MOTOR X258,
Abstract
Rocket motor X258 is a case-bonded, compositemodified double-base solid propellant system which uses reinforced plastic and aluminum for all major inert components. The unit packages 506 pounds of propellant in 70 pounds of inert weight. Weight at burnout is approximately 63 pounds. The X258 delivers 143,200 lbs-sec of total impulse when operating in vacuum. Rocket Motor X258 was developed as the fourth stage power plant for the Scout launching vehicle. This manual gives a brief description of rocket motor X258 and the operating, handling, and storage instructions necessary for its proper use. (Author)
